修改编译脚本适配pqdif,同步61850日志上送逻辑
This commit is contained in:
@@ -20,9 +20,10 @@ $SRC_DIR/tinyxml2.cpp \
|
||||
./dealMsg.cpp \
|
||||
./main_thread.cpp \
|
||||
./PQSMsg.cpp \
|
||||
./pqdif_thread_processor.cpp \
|
||||
./pqdif/PQDIF.cpp \
|
||||
./pqdif/include/cjson.c "
|
||||
./pqdif_semantic_ids.cpp \
|
||||
./pqdif_thread_processor.cpp \
|
||||
./pqdif/include/cjson.c"
|
||||
|
||||
INCLUDE_DIRS="-I$SRC_DIR \
|
||||
-I$SRC_DIR/nlohmann \
|
||||
@@ -33,20 +34,22 @@ INCLUDE_DIRS="-I$SRC_DIR \
|
||||
-I./lib/libuv-v1.51.0/include \
|
||||
-I./pqdif \
|
||||
-I./pqdif/include \
|
||||
-I. "
|
||||
-I. "
|
||||
|
||||
LIB_DIRS="-L$LIB_DIR -L/usr/lib64 -L/usr/local/lib"
|
||||
LIB_DIRS="-L$LIB_DIR -L./pqdif/lib -L/usr/lib64 -L/usr/local/lib"
|
||||
|
||||
LIBS="./cloudfront/lib/libcurl.so \
|
||||
./cloudfront/lib/libssl.so \
|
||||
./cloudfront/lib/libcrypto.so \
|
||||
./cloudfront/lib/liblog4cplus.so \
|
||||
./pqdif/lib/libpqdiflib.a \
|
||||
./pqdif/lib/libz.a \
|
||||
-lpthread -ldl -lrt \
|
||||
-lstdc++fs \
|
||||
-lz \
|
||||
./libuv.a \
|
||||
-Wl,--start-group \
|
||||
./pqdif/lib/libpqdiflib.a \
|
||||
./pqdif/lib/libz.a \
|
||||
-Wl,--end-group \
|
||||
-pthread"
|
||||
|
||||
# 如果有静态 rocketmq 库就加上
|
||||
@@ -74,4 +77,4 @@ if [ $? -eq 0 ]; then
|
||||
ldd "$OUT_DIR/$TARGET" || echo "是静态编译程序 ✔"
|
||||
else
|
||||
echo "❌ 编译失败"
|
||||
fi
|
||||
fi
|
||||
|
||||
Reference in New Issue
Block a user